Operaciones Matemáticas en Solidez

Solidity es un lenguaje de programación completamente nuevo creado por Ethereum , que es el segundo mercado más grande de criptomonedas por capitalización, lanzado en el año 2015 dirigido por Christian Reitwiessner. Ethereum es una plataforma de código abierto descentralizada basada en el dominio blockchain, que se utiliza para ejecutar contratos inteligentes, es decir, aplicaciones … Continue reading «Operaciones Matemáticas en Solidez»

Solidez – Variables – Part 1

Una variable es básicamente un marcador de posición para los datos que se pueden manipular en tiempo de ejecución. Las variables permiten a los usuarios recuperar y cambiar la información almacenada.  Reglas para nombrar variables 1. Un nombre de variable no debe coincidir con palabras clave reservadas. 2. Los nombres de las variables deben comenzar … Continue reading «Solidez – Variables – Part 1»

Introducción a la Solidez

Solidity es un lenguaje de programación completamente nuevo creado por Ethereum , que es el segundo mercado más grande de criptomonedas por capitalización, lanzado en el año 2015 dirigido por Christian Reitwiessner. Algunas características clave de la solidez se enumeran a continuación:  Solidity es un lenguaje de programación de alto nivel diseñado para implementar contratos … Continue reading «Introducción a la Solidez»

Solidez – Tipos

Solidity es un lenguaje tipado estáticamente, lo que implica que se debe especificar el tipo de cada una de las variables. Los tipos de datos permiten al compilador verificar el uso correcto de las variables. Los tipos declarados tienen algunos valores predeterminados llamados Zero-State , por ejemplo, para bool, el valor predeterminado es False. Del … Continue reading «Solidez – Tipos»

Solidez – Operadores

En cualquier lenguaje de programación, los operadores juegan un papel vital, es decir, crean una base para la programación. Del mismo modo, la funcionalidad de Solidity también está incompleta sin el uso de operadores. Los operadores permiten a los usuarios realizar diferentes operaciones en los operandos. Solidity admite los siguientes tipos de operadores en función … Continue reading «Solidez – Operadores»

¿Cómo instalar Solidity en macOS?

Solidity es un lenguaje de programación utilizado para escribir contratos inteligentes para muchas plataformas de blockchain, la más común de las cuales es ethereum. Es un lenguaje de programación basado en objetos que se ejecuta en EVM (Ethereum Virtual Machine) que ejecuta los contratos inteligentes. A continuación se detallan los pasos para instalar solidity en … Continue reading «¿Cómo instalar Solidity en macOS?»

¿Qué es el contrato inteligente de depósito en garantía?

El fideicomiso es el tercero que posee el activo (el activo puede ser dinero, bonos, acciones) en presencia de dos partes. El fideicomiso liberará el fondo cuando se cumplan ciertas condiciones. Por ejemplo, «A» es un vendedor y quiere vender su automóvil, «B» es un comprador que quiere comprar el automóvil de «A», por lo … Continue reading «¿Qué es el contrato inteligente de depósito en garantía?»